LIHU‘E — Student artists 15 years old and younger are invited to enter in Toyota’s 7th Dream Car Art Contest presented by Toyota Hawai‘i.
The hand-drawn entries must be submitted Feb. 25 to any Toyota dealer in the state or mailed to Toyota Dream Car Art Contest, P.O. Box 2788, Honolulu, Hawai‘i 96803.
Entry forms are available at ToyotaHawaii.com and Kaua‘i Toyota.
Eligible submissions will be entered into the People’s Choice Competition, where people can vote for their favorites through the Toyota Hawai‘i Facebook page beginning Tuesday.
Voting ends Feb. 28.
In March, a judging panel will select nine local finalists to submit to the World Contest.
One winner from each age group will receive an iPad Mini and the other two finalists in each category will each receive $150 cash.
If any of the Hawai‘i entries receive merits in the World Contest, those students will enjoy an all-expenses-paid trip to Japan to participate in the final awards ceremony in August 2013.
All final awards ceremony participants will have a chance to meet Toyota Motor Corporation President Akio Toyoda and Executive Vice President Yukitoshi Funo in Toyota City, Aichi Prefecture.
Student artists will compete in three age categories: 10 years old and younger; 10 to 12 years old; and 13 to 15 years old.
